Frewen College

Co-educational boarding and day, East Sussex

Frewen College is a leading school for children aged 7-19 with dyslexia, dyspraxia, dyscalculia and speech, language and communication needs.

It is the oldest dyslexia school in the UK and possibly the world. Our school combines a beautiful country house and park setting with easy accessibility. London is just over an hour by train, Gatwick Airport one hour by taxi.

Classes are appropriately small, and all our highly experienced teachers are trained to teach in a dyslexia-friendly way in all lessons. Staff and students are extremely proud to have recently been voted the ‘Best Dyslexia-Friendly School’ by the British Dyslexia Association.

We are a small school and have students of all academic abilities, with dyslexia and related needs and yet our students regularly exceed national expectations. In 2019 GCSE 9-4 grades (A*-C) and the all-important progress or ‘value added’ scores increased significantly, for the fifth consecutive year. Boarders benefit from a wide variety of sport and a full and varied programme of weekend activities and visits.
